Expertise is a cornerstone when discussing the handwheel mechanism associated with this butterfly valve. Unlike lever-operated valves, the handwheel provides a fine degree of control, crucial for applications requiring precise adjustments. The manual operation is intuitive, allowing for immediate feedback and adjustments by the operator. This control mechanism is particularly advantageous in scenarios where automation isn’t feasible, or in systems designed to prioritize human oversight.

Professionals choosing the di lug type butterfly valve also appreciate its streamlined installation process. Typically designed with compatibility in mind, these valves fit seamlessly into existing pipelines without requiring significant modifications. This feature is beneficial for facilities looking to upgrade their systems with minimal downtime. Additionally, the di lug configuration allows for easy removal and maintenance, thanks to its bolt-on design, reducing labor costs and improving efficiency.
